My name is Joanna. I have a speech disorder called Speech Apraxia. Apraxia is a speech sound disorder where one has trouble saying
words correctly. The brain knows what it wants to say, but cannot say the sounds properly. I am educating people on what it's like living with Speech Apraxia or any disability, but I am focusing on my disability the most.
